Bachelors in Media & Communication in Poland
19 bachelors programmes in media & communication at 10 universities in Poland are open to international students; 100% are taught in English. The median yearly tuition is 3,092 USD, with the middle half of programmes charging between 1,923 USD and 3,150 USD.
